Integrating "Algebra 1 Vocabulary Word Search" into the Classroom
The effectiveness of "algebra 1 vocabulary word search" depends significantly on its thoughtful integration into the curriculum. It should not be used as a standalone activity but rather as a supplementary tool to reinforce concepts taught in class. Here are some effective strategies:
Pre-lesson activity: Use a word search to introduce key vocabulary before a new lesson. This primes students for the concepts they'll be learning, improving comprehension.
Post-lesson review: As a review activity, a word search reinforces concepts learned during a lesson, helping students solidify their understanding.
Differentiated instruction: Create word searches with varying levels of difficulty to cater to diverse learner needs. Some word searches can include simpler terms, while others can include more complex terms and definitions.
Group work and collaboration: Encourage students to work together on word searches, fostering collaborative learning and peer support.
Gamification: Turn the word search into a friendly competition, awarding points or small prizes for speed and accuracy. This adds an element of fun and motivation.
Addressing Potential Challenges and Limitations
While "algebra 1 vocabulary word search" offers many advantages, it's important to acknowledge potential limitations. Simply using a word search without connecting it to the broader learning objectives won't yield significant results. Furthermore, it's crucial to avoid relying solely on this method for vocabulary instruction. It's most effective when integrated with other teaching strategies, such as direct instruction, practice problems, and real-world applications. Over-reliance on such games might also lead to neglecting other essential learning aspects. Moreover, ensuring the word search aligns with the curriculum’s specific learning objectives is paramount.
